In February this year, Holly Willats (Director, Art Licks) and independent curator Lily Hall stayed in Bogotá, Colombia for one month in residence at FLORA ars + natura. In the last few years Bogotá’s arts scene has found itself under the spotlight as one of the burgeoning global creative centres. Art Licks' aim during this residency was to explore the local art scene as much as possible, to meet with artists, curators, directors and writers to discuss what it is like to work in this city, and to see the realities behind this media boom.
Issue 21 of Art Licks is based on this time in Bogotá: the contributions are from artists, curators and writers who Holly and Lily met and felt inspired by. We do not intend for this issue of Art Licks to act as a guide for visiting Colombia, but instead continue in the same vein as all of the previous issues of the magazine: offering insight into what early career artists are currently concerned with, their experiences of working and looking at the support structures around them.
